Car slams into restaurant at Westlake strip mall, injuring five people
Five people were injured Sunday evening when a vehicle slammed into a strip-mall restaurant in Westlake, authorities said.
The crash at 806 S. Alvarado St. happened about 5 p.m., said Los Angeles Fire Department spokesperson Margaret Stewart.
Five people were taken to a hospital, three of them in critical condition.
No other details were available on the circumstances of the crash.
